TOP of the agenda at tonight’s annual meeting of the Bovey Tracey Hospital League Friends will be health chiefs’ recommendation that the establishment should be closed.
Among those at the meeting at the Methodist Church Hall (7pm) will be community hospital assistant director Pat McDonag and a representative of MP Mel Stride.
The announcement of the renewed call for closure, first mooted in 2013, was revealed last week.
